Output 189ce78852cfe9472e6f31981d15d9534ae8352de42ec26f0b2c65100620715f:0

value
186550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85348ea8ad2254d125cc359b83b0a0615142f28c OP_EQUAL
address
3DqLkoLZKj8gyMGVBEwirqkgpPkyMKjaRy
transaction
189ce78852cfe9472e6f31981d15d9534ae8352de42ec26f0b2c65100620715f